: This is the video compression codec used to encode the file. H.264/MPEG-4 AVC (implemented via the x264 encoder) is the industry standard for digital video compatibility. It strikes an ideal balance between relatively small file sizes and high visual fidelity, playable on almost any device (Smart TVs, laptops, phones, or media servers like Plex). The release string points directly to a high-definition digital copy of Fado , a gripping psychological drama directed by Jonas Rothlaender. Debuting in 2016, this film serves as a harrowing exploration of toxic masculinity, obsessive jealousy, and emotional degradation. Set against the melancholic backdrop of Lisbon, Portugal, the movie uses both its geographic setting and its sharp cinematic style to mirror the internal chaos of its protagonist.
